The 2011 Houston Dynamo jersey keeps the team's trademark orange color and features a design similar to the Netherlands kits from the late 80s and early 90s when Adidas designed the Brilliant Orange's kits.

The pattern is unique to the Dynamo and no other Major League Soccer team currently has a shirt with a similar pattern and design. Another new feature of the jersey is the long-rumored white collar, another throwback to soccer jerseys from the past. Also, the baby blue color, a feature of the current home and away jerseys has been reduced to a minimum amount and is only located on the piping on the edges of the shirt.

Unconfirmed sources state that the white away kit will feature a similar design but in a white colorway and will have orange piping instead of blue piping.

Another interesting component of the leaked kit is the presence of what appears to be the Dynamo's new shirt sponsor, Greenstar Recycling. Greenstar Recycling is a fourth-generation family owner waste management and recycling company headquartered in Houston. Calls made to Greenstar to confirm their sponsorship deal were not returned at the time of this article.
